ESPN's deep dive analysis paints a clear picture about how the Bengals attacked NFL free agency

Going big in free agency can be very risky. The Cincinnati Bengals have had their share of whiffs since they started legitimately investing in the open market at the start of the 2020s, but without doing so, they wouldn't have their best two-year run in franchise history from 2021-22.
